Cell Application Growth - Present Technologies

Smartphones are a massive good results story of the earlier twenty years - and the equipment get far more highly effective on a yearly basis. A lot of firms attain significant Added benefits by using cellular technology - together with All those in equally industrial and professional marketplaces. Deploying purposes to mobile users requires a singular list of problems and possibilities.

This information supplies a qualifications on the current cellular technologies available.

Kinds of Software for Cellular

The elemental thing to consider with delivering small business applications in excess of mobile phones is the massive amount of units, along with the wide selection of functions on these.

Prosperous cellular software improvement typically includes a mix of technologies and tactics. This is where a diverse talent established, along with an idea of the mobile landscape, is vital to offer corporations not only with development expert services but also productive guidance During this time of accelerating adjust. The difficulties at this time in cellular technology are mirrored by an ever-rising range of opportunities for firms to carry out new and improved processes.

Usually, there are two principal methods to providing small business methods more than mobiles:

(1) Net

The cell Website has been through monumental developments over the past number of years. In line with the latest research, all over a 3rd of Grownups in the united kingdom are now using a smartphone - it seems pretty Safe and sound to suppose that this will only carry on to extend. Numerous more cell end users have some type of Access to the internet. Even though the functionality of cell Net browsers has become at a very good degree, there are still significant limitations with regard to network connectivity and velocity - this is expected to further improve in excess of another handful of decades as 4G kicks in, but for The instant remains a significant constraint.

A lot of organisations develop cellular variations of their websites and World-wide-web expert services, with minimised material built to cope with mobile components and details connectivity limits. One probably worthwhile prospect while in the cell Internet would be the advance of HTML5. This technology continues to be greatly below progress, but with key websites including the Money Periods opting to work with it instead of focusing on particular cell platforms it does glance quite promising. HTML5 provides A variety of Added benefits which include facilities for offline guidance, multi-media, interactivity and location awareness.

(two) Cellular Apps

Native cellular applications are program solutions deployed right onto devices for example phones. Several mobile apps url to World-wide-web companies, with the appliance, or "application", dealing with person conversation natively. Cell apps hold the gain that they offer a deep degree of interactivity that may be suited to system hardware - for example, working with gestures or sensors like GPS. The difficulty with applying cellular programs to provide organization services is the number of platforms in Procedure. As of early 2011, Google, Apple and RIM together occupy about ninety% of the smartphone market. Nevertheless, the mobile landscape is still in a very condition of adjust and there are actually other gamers which includes Windows and Palm - It could be unwise to help make any predictions about how marketplace share will search even in the make a difference of months as things stand.

Microsoft have changed the Windows Cellular procedure with Windows Cellular phone seven, with a heightened give attention to shopper use. While Microsoft at the moment provides a diminished posture concerning smartphone market share, the impending Mango release is hunting incredibly promising, and it is being received quite well in early testing.

With regard to technologies for cell applications, the list is extensive, and depends on which platform (or platforms) you end up picking to target. Among the most often utilized programming languages for cell purposes are Java, Objective C and C++. Each of the foremost platforms has a selected Application Enhancement kit, with its personal resources to assist with the design, tests, debugging and deployment.

The complexity of cellular application development is these kinds of that concentrating on even just one System involves substantial screening. Some companies maximise on growth methods by balancing indigenous consumer conversation with cross-platform methods at the back-conclude, wherein case a mobile app can successfully operate as an interface for an internet software.

SMS

Besides concentrating on specific mobile platforms by way of software package and Website enhancement, you'll find further methods to use cellular contexts for a few business enterprise processes - SMS is one these types of scenario. Within this product, providers are sent as SMS textual content messages. This has the benefit of normally Operating throughout all phones, and payment is often taken care of by means of consumers charges - but it's a really constrained kind of interaction. SMS also has a difficulty that information shipping and delivery just isn't confirmed. Integrating SMS information managing into World wide web apps is quite very simple - and support for processing SMS messages from end users is commonly accessible.

About Android

Google's Android operating system is going from power to strength at this time. Possessing in the beginning been witnessed for a System of fascination mostly to geeks, Android now occupies all over a third of smartphone market place share. Android's advancement is partly right down to the openness of your System, which is obtainable on phones across the industry array and from different hardware suppliers, rendering it available to a far more diverse range of customers than iPhone.

Apps out there through the Android Industry are also subject to little Command, which makes Mobile Application Development quite a lot of assortment and flexibility but Obviously results in an increased proportion of weak top quality apps in circulation.

Google's tactic is the alternative of Apple - which retains major control in excess of its cell phone running process. Google's First concept was to make a new cellphone running method which would be open and cost-free. Their hope was that This may encourage ground breaking enhancement of equally phones and programs. Google has invested in Android as it anticipated that Internet queries would ever more happen on mobiles, and it wished to be able to promote to cellular consumers.

While Google's position inside the cellular earth appears really solid today, it remains to be tricky to say how matters are going to progress. With regard to buyers and applications, Android has, previously, been viewed by quite a few as much more focused on shopper services than enterprise use when put next with Apple and RIM, but there is some evidence that this is shifting. The Android procedure is featuring a good volume of integration with organization solutions including Microsoft Exchange, as well as the open up character of your System can make integrating with present company applications potentially fewer troublesome than for certain rivals.

About apple iphone

The apple iphone was naturally in a dominant placement because the advance in the smartphone took form, plus the platform remains to be in a really highly effective put. While business people By natural means tended towards Blackberry in the past, both of those iPhone and Android have continued to produce appreciable headway for enterprise in addition to client use, whilst Blackberry has started out catering much more to The patron user as well. The result is that each one a few of the major smartphone platforms at the moment are occupying a few of the similar House.

The apple iphone provides assistance for external small business utilities which include Microsoft Trade and, unlike Android, iPhone apps are matter to severe vetting right before end users can deploy them. The all-natural draw back to this greater level of Command around the platform as a whole is an absence of adaptability, but for business apps the in addition side is an extremely substantial promise of top quality and dependability for the finish user - and in the end for just about any enterprise processes staying implemented with the technological know-how.

With all the vastly well-liked Visible styles and interaction versions the manufacturer is well-known for, the Canadian Mobile App Developers apple iphone is absolutely a lovely platform for industrial programs. Apple have been accountable for establishing modern characteristics whose results has prompted other platforms to emulate them, such as multi-contact conversation.

There are a few severe factors with iPhone progress:

Apple will not permit buyers to straight install programs onto the iPhone - all purposes must be bought in the Apple Retail outlet, and Apple takes a thirty% Reduce. There might be a way all-around this in the future, but at present we are not aware of it.

image

For specified apps the fragility, financial value and battery life of the iPhone could pose complications.

Not surprisingly, these road blocks apply typically to business / industrial purposes. They aren't particularly a problem in terms of generating stop-consumer programs. Blueberry has the Objective C skills necessary to create apple iphone packages, and we'd be quite considering talking about this with clients.

Whilst iPhone has dropped considerable smartphone ground to both of those Blackberry and Android, it is generally nonetheless seen since the platform to defeat, and continues to be a marketplace leader in some ways.

About RIM Blackberry

RIM's Blackberry System was extensive viewed as the cell process of choice for enterprise and Experienced users, a notion that also persists to a specific degree. Over the past several years Blackberry has also designed major advancements in The buyer current market, introducing handsets that have demonstrated Particularly common among younger smartphone buyers.

Like Android, Blackberry hardware is quite various, so users can accessibility mobile web pages and apps through differing display screen measurements and controls - growing the complexity in any improvement project. The Blackberry platform delivers a wealth of business expert services as regular, with Blackberry Organization Server found as A significant asset for corporate people. Electronic mail on Blackberry is particularly strong, so people who are depending on a higher degree of safety and dependability in messaging (and communications in general) Obviously have a tendency to this platform.

Even though iPhones are focused on touchscreen conversation, as are Android devices to a slightly lesser degree, Blackberry handsets are more than likely to deliver components keyboards for text input. This may be a critical factor within the likely on the System for specified application classes.

A attainable challenge for cellular Website purposes targeted at Blackberry would be that the World-wide-web browsers on the program have, in the past, been substantially much less State-of-the-art than All those on both of those iPhone and Android. However, More moderen designs have resolved this situation by such as the hottest WebKit browser

Indigenous applications might be deployed through the Blackberry Application Entire world marketplace, that has, so far, not occupied as central a job for buyers because the app shops on iPhone and Android, although the model is clearly concentrating intensive efforts on building this facet of use.

About Windows Cellular

Windows Cellular and Windows Phone seven represent Microsoft's foray into the cell world, which has appreciated different levels of good results in the consumer and industrial markets.

From The patron perspective, in the intervening time several of the top quality smartphone models for example HTC and LG are generating handsets With all the Windows Phone functioning process deployed on them, with networks which includes O2 and Orange providing cellular companies. Nokia and Windows have attained A significant offer through which the manufacturer is dropping its Symbian System entirely to target Windows as its operating process of preference.

In 2011, Microsoft is due to release A significant new edition on the mobile Windows System named Mango. This A great deal anticipated release could change the placement of Microsoft substantially within the mobile environment, partly on account with the Nokia partnership and partly Because the process is set to include a number of new capabilities which include elevated assistance for HTML5.

Concurrently, Windows Mobile has also been adopted strongly by suppliers of industrial PDAs and mobiles - transportable computing product merchandise suitable for professional as opposed to customer use. This has viewed Microsoft Checking out different industrial contexts for cellular processing, with Windows Mobile 6.five significantly productive in these environments, and components made by different suppliers together with Motorola. Home windows Cell is hence a pure option for several cell workplace wants, which include warehouse and shipping companies.

From the development point of view, Windows Cell has incredibly potent rewards. Microsoft has supplied a prosperous System of development equipment - such as the C# language, that is less of a challenge to use than C applied on other mobiles. Microsoft also contains resources for interaction involving software package on the phone and central servers, plus they even contain a small databases engine.

The powerful progress equipment and huge availability of different equipment make Home windows Cell a very important System for delivering organization programs. At Blueberry Now we have a uniquely significant degree of experience on Windows Mobile systems, so are very well positioned to deliver solutions on this System.